The fictional [[galaxy]] where the setting of the ''[[Star Wars]]'' saga occurs is known simply as the '''Star Wars galaxy''' while in the canon it is referred as the Galaxy or the Known Galaxy. Fans refer to it as the '''Galaxy Far Far Away''' or '''GFFA''' for short. Judging from the maps, it appears to be a galaxy of [[Galaxy classification|Sb type]]. According to some sources the length of the galaxy is 120,000 light years across.

There are approximately 400 billion stars and around half of these have planets that can support life.  10% of those developed life, while [[sentience|sentient]] life developed in 1/1000 of those (about 20 million).

===Deep Core===
The '''Deep Core''' is at the center of the galaxy, even closer than the [[Core Worlds]] like [[Coruscant]] and [[Alderaan]].

It has countless stars packed together in a relatively small area, so hyperspace travel is slow and dangerous.  The intense radiation and relatively young stars mean that it has very few inhabitable worlds compared to the rest of the galaxy.  After the [[Battle of Endor]], Imperial forces loyal to the ressurected Emperor [[Palpatine]] fortified the Deep Core as a bastion of Imperial might.

The few known worlds of the Deep Core include [[Byss]], Khomm, Ruan, and the [[List of Star Wars Planets#Empress Teta|Empress Teta]] system.  The [[Koornacht Cluster]] is one particularly dense area of stars, located at the edge of the Deep Core bordering on the Core Worlds, and contains numerous planets including [[N'Zoth]], the homeworld of the [[Yevetha]]. The moon [[Ebaq 9]] was the setting for a major battle during the [[Yuuzhan Vong invasion]], resulting in a [[New Republic (Star Wars)|New Republic]] victory following the successful execution of a trap for the [[Yuuzhan Vong]]

===Core Worlds===
The '''Core Worlds''' are the known worlds, or planetary systems, that are near the core of the Star Wars galaxy. These worlds are rumored to be the first planets in the Star Wars universe to hold [[Human (Star Wars)|human]] life. These humans expanded and formed the [[Old Republic]]. [[Coruscant]] is by far the most important of the Core worlds and is, according to legend, the source of the first humans. However, there are numerous other worlds which can be found in this dense region of the galaxy. The Core can be divided into three regions: The Deep Core, the Core Proper and the Colonies (sometimes considered a separate region). The Deep Core is the location of the Koornacht Cluster, Byss, Ebaq and countless other worlds; so many, in fact, that hyperspace travel through the Core is tedious and even treacherous. It was to [[Byss]] that the dis-embodied consciousness of Emperor [[Palpatine]] fled to in the years following his death at the [[Battle of Endor]].  

The Core Worlds contain millions of systems, including Coruscant, [[Alderaan]], [[Corellia]], [[Chandrila]], [[List of Star Wars planets (M-N)#Nubia|Nubia]], [[List of Star Wars planets (C-D)#Duro|Duro]], and [[Ciutric]]. Less dense than the Deep Core, the Core Worlds are the center of commerce and society in the galaxy as they lie on the intersection of the many great hyperspace lanes. The Colonies include Commenor, [[Cato Neimoidia]], and Bilbringi, as well as numerous other worlds which have served as stage for the great [[Galactic Civil War]] in the fight between the [[Galactic Empire (Star Wars)|Empire]] and the [[Rebel Alliance]].

===Colonies===
The '''Colonies''' were some of the first planets settled outside the [[Core Worlds]] by the [[Galactic Republic (Star Wars)|Republic]], especially the region known as "''The Slice''", defined by the edges of the Perlemian Trade Route and the Corellian Run. There were also Worlds in the Colonies that were founding members of the Republic. After 25,000 years, the worlds are almost as influential as the Core, being just as industrialized and with firmly established cultures, with many worlds supporting vast shipyard complexes. Important manufacturing planets are Fondor, where the Super Star Destroyer ''[[Executor (Star Wars)|Executor]]'' was built, and Balmorra, a major [[TIE]] producer. [[Arkania]] is home to the Arkanians, a near Human species skilled at genetics and cybernetics. Mrlsst, home of the Mrlssi, is a famous university world also located in the Colonies.  Many of [[Kuat Drive Yards]]' factory worlds are located here, as are the [[Neimoidian]] purse worlds, Neimoidia, [[Cato Neimoidia]], Deku Neimoidia, and Koru Neimoidia.

During the [[Galactic Civil War]], the [[Galactic Empire (Star Wars)|Empire]] ruthlessly controlled the region. After the death of [[Palpatine|Emperor Palpatine]], most of the Region joined the [[New Republic (Star Wars)|New Republic]].

===Inner Rim===
The '''Inner Rim''' is the section of the galaxy between the Colonies and the Expansion Region. Some planets in this galactic ring include Rendili and Omar.   There is no reason given as to why the Inner Rim comes prior to the Expansion Region.

===Expansion Region===
The '''Expansion Region''' is precisely what it sounds like; it is territory colonized during a sudden expansion from the Inner Rim territories.  During most of the [[Galactic Republic|Old Republic]], it was considered a vast field of raw materials.  The [[Galactic Empire (Star Wars)|Empire]] treated the Expansion Region as an area to obtain slaves, and [[stripmining|strip-mined]] the entire belt of worlds.  Mandalore, Nkllon, and Kalarba are planets located within this region.

===Mid Rim===
The Mid Rim is a galactic ring located between the Outer Rim and Inner Rim/Expansion Regions.  On the border of the division lies Nam Chorios and the Meridian Sector.  Other planets in the area include [[Naboo]], Ithor, and Ord Mantell.  Not long after the [[Battle of Endor]], most of it was seized by the [[Galactic Empire (Star Wars)|Imperial]] warlord [[Admiral Teradoc]].

===Outer Rim===
{{main|Outer Rim Territories}}
The '''Outer Rim Territories''' is the outermost part of the explored portion of the [[Star Wars galaxy|''Star Wars'' galaxy]]. During the long period of the [[Galactic Republic]], the Outer Rims were almost isolated, this is due to many unchartered regions and planets, untouched for countless centuries. Because of this isolation from other worlds, it became a breeding ground for criminals and scum. Seen in ''[[Star Wars Episode IV: A New Hope]]'', the [[Galactic Empire (Star Wars)|Galactic Empire]]'s presence is made known in the area. Because of the Empire's corrupt type of government, many criminals still retained their criminal underworlds, such as the infamous [[Jabba the Hutt]].

===Wild Space===
'''Wild Space''' is on the frontier of the known galaxy, and is the blurred edge separating civilization from the [[Unknown Regions]]. Planets in this region lie so far from the galactic centers of power that they are virtually ignored. Very few people have ventured into Wild Space and into the Unknown Regions.  Technically speaking, Wild Space extends beyond the galaxy in some areas. [[Outbound Flight]], a Jedi project to explore realms beyond the known galaxy, crossed through Wild Space en route to the Unknown Regions.

===Unknown Regions===
The '''Unknown Regions''' lie beyond the region known as [[Wild Space]].  They are uncharted by any of the known galactic powers.

After the [[Mandalorian]] War [[Revan]] and [[Malak]] led a fifth of the Republic fleet, claiming to be searching for more Mandalorians, into this region. The fleet vanished for months and was presumed lost. Later the fleet returned with ships of alien design and started attacking the Republic. This lead to the start of the [[Jedi Civil War]]. After the Jedi Civil War, Darth Revan left into these unknown regions again and has not returned since. It is rumored he went to fight the true [[Sith]]. Little is known of where he went or when Revan will return, but many are waiting. The [[Jedi Exile]] went to the Unknown Regions 5 years later to help Revan with this task. The fate of the two Jedi remains unknown.

[[Csilla]], home to the [[Chiss]], is one of the only known inhabited planets in the Unknown Regions. The Chiss [[Grand Admiral]], [[Thrawn]], was tasked by [[Palpatine|Emperor Palpatine]] to lead a pacification mission into the Unknown Regions, a duty that Thrawn carried out until five years after the Emperor's death. Furthermore, the ancient insectoid [[Killik]] race inhabits this region of space; their territory borders Chiss space. Rakata Prime, the Rakatan homeworld, is also located in the Unknown Regions.

In the ''New Jedi Order'' book series, the living planet of [[Zonoma Sekot]] flees into the Unknown Regions after being attacked by the Empire. The Jedi find record of the planet's travels after extensive searching, and the Jedi Luke Skywalker leads a team of other Jedi to search for the world in the Unknown Regions; record shows it repelled the Yuuzhang Vong in the past and the Jedi now seek a new ally to help once again thwart the invading Yuuzhang Vong. They eventually are successful and persuade the living planet to attempt a hazardous return to known space.

==Political areas==
Other minor political areas include:

'''Bothan Space''' &mdash; A region between the Mid Rim and Outer Rim, which is home to the Bothan race.  The capital of Bothan Space is Bothawui.  The Caamas incident, involving the genocide of the planet Caamas, took place in this region.

'''Hutt Space''' &mdash; A region in the [[Outer Rim Territories]], which is controlled by criminal gangsters known as the [[Hutts]]. It was subjugated by the [[Yuuzhan Vong]] during their invasion after the Hutts attempted to double cross them. The space is comprised of planets such as [[Nal Hutta]] and [[Ylesia]]. The Y'toub system is the location of both Nal Hutta, and the Smuggler's Moon, [[Nar Shaddaa]]. It is surrounded by the planets [[List_of_Star_Wars_planets (A-B)#Bimmisaari|Bimmisaari]], [[List_of_Star_Wars_planets (K-L)#Kubindi|Kubindi]], [[List_of_Star_Wars_planets (K-L)#Kessel|Kessel]], [[List_of_Star_Wars_planets (H-J)#Honoghr|Honoghr]], [[List_of_Star_Wars_planets (A-B)#Barabil|Barabi]] and [[List_of_Star_Wars_planets (E-G)#Gamorr|Gamorr]]. The [[Tion Cluster]] is the right and [[Bothan Space]] to the left.

'''[[Corporate Sector Authority]]''' &mdash; The government of a [[free enterprise]] [[fiefdom]] known as the '''Corporate Sector''' that was formed in 490 [[Dates in Star Wars|BBY]] to free the [[Galactic Republic|Republic]] lawmakers and the Corporate moneymakers from their differences. During the height of [[Palpatine|Emperor Palpatine]]'s rule of the galaxy, the Corporate Sector Authority comprised of 30,000 star systems. During the [[Yuuzhan Vong]] invasion, the Corporate Sector isolated itself from the Galaxy.

'''[[Tion Hegemony]]''' &mdash; Also known as the Ancient and Honorable Union of the Tion Hegemony, this sector of the Tion Cluster is a collection of 27 star systems. It is far from the Core Worlds, but embraces some of the oldest and most ancient human civilizations in the galaxy. As time went on, the Hegemony lost power, but the it remained the breadbasket of the Tion, providing foodstuffs for all three of the Tion's sectors.

'''Cronese Mandate''' &mdash; A small government within the galaxy.

'''[[Hapes Consortium]]''' &mdash; An female-dominated alliance of sixty-three worlds. It originated as a base for pirates and privateers, but soon turned into a high class society with elegent ship designs and sprawling cities. The chief of state is the [[Queen Mother]]. The Queen Mother is also head of the royal family. It is the task of the prince to find a wife who will give birth to the next Queen Mother. 

'''[[Ssi-Ruuk Star Cluster]]''' &mdash; Also known as the Ssi-ruuvi Imperium, this cluster of planets was inhabited by the technologically-advanced Ssi-Ruuk.  It is located beyond the Outer Rim.

'''[[The Centrality]]''' &mdash; An independent government in a large and remote region of space nestled between [[Hutt Space]] and the [[Cron Drift]].  It was a empty region lacking many stable [[hyperspace route]]s, with areas so devoid of systems that some travelers would run out of fuel before finishing their journeys even halfway.

'''[[Imperial Remnant]]''' &mdash; The remainder of the [[Galactic Empire (Star Wars)|Galactic Empire]] that came about following the Bastion Accords that ended the [[Galactic Civil War]]. Its capital of Bastion, located deep in the Outer Rim.

==Traffic==
Various established 'ways' pass through the sectors.
====Corellian Run====
The '''Corellian Run''' originates in the [[Corellia|Corellian System]] and ends somewhere in Wild Space.

====Corellian Trade Spine====
The '''Corellian Trade Spine''' begins at [[Corellia]], crosses the Rimma Trade Route at [[List of Star Wars planets#Yag'Dhul|Yag'Dhul]], and branches into the Ison Trade Corridor in the [[Outer Rim Territories|Outer Rim]].

====Hydian Way====
The '''Hydian Way''' begins at [[Corellia]], intersects the Perlemain Trade Route at [[List of Star Wars planets#Brentaal|Brentaal]], and snakes up the Tingel Arm to its termination in the [[Corporate Sector]].

====Ison Corridor====
The '''Ison Trade Corridor''' is a lightly populated minor trade route in the [[Outer Rim Territories|Outer Rim]] of the [[Star Wars galaxy]].  It branches off from the Corellian Trade Spine and passes through such backwater planets as [[List of Star Wars planets#Varonat|Varonat]], [[Bespin]], [[Hoth]], and [[List of Star Wars planets#Ison|Ison]] before meeting back up with the trade spine.

====Perlemian Trade Route====
The '''Perlemian Trade Route''' is a major hyperspace corridor. Beginning at [[Coruscant]], it crosses the Hydian Way at [[List of Star Wars planets#Brentaal|Brentaal]] and ends in the [[Outer Rim Territories|Outer Rim]] in between the [[Corporate Sector]] and the [[Tion Cluster]].

====Rimma Trade Route====
The '''Rimma Trade Route''' was initially established by [[Sectors of Star Wars#Tapani|Tapani Sector]] merchants around 5,500 [[BBY]].  It begins in the Core worlds near [[Planets of Star Wars#Fondor|Fondor]], intersects the Corellian Trade Spine at [[Planets of Star Wars#Yag'Dhul|Yag'Dhul]], and travels through [[Sullust]] and [[Planets of Star Wars#Sluis Van|Sluis Van]] before its end, in the Kathol Sector.

====Kessel Run====
The '''Kessel Run''' is a pathway from planet [[List of Star Wars planets (K-L)#Kessel|Kessel]] in the [[Star Wars]] galaxy used frequently by smugglers in the transport of precious [[Glitterstim spice]].

A well-known but confusing description of the Kessel Run is made by [[Han Solo]] in ''[[A New Hope]]'' when he boasts to have made the run with the [[Millennium Falcon]] in "less than twelve [[parsec]]s."  A parsec is a unit of distance, not a measure of time or speed.  Some have explained this apparent error by postulating the presence of a [[black hole]] cluster ([[The Maw]]) close to Kessel, which is used by pilots to shorten the distance of the run. 

According to [[Expanded Universe (Star Wars)|Expanded Universe]] literature, navigating the Maw black hole cluster is extremely hazardous. Ships making runs must take long complex courses to avoid the dangerous [[singularities]] and gravity distortions of the cluster. However, it is speculated that Solo brazenly shaved by the gravity wells, thus achieving a run under a distance of 12 parsecs where a safer route would be much longer. This shorter run, by necessity, would require a faster ship than more circuitious routes, since a slower ship would not be able to resist the gravitational pull of the closer black-holes.

The question of whether Solo was boasting about the speed of his ship, or his skillful abilities at piloting is still debated amongst fans. One could also look at the wording of the quote and consider Solo may have been mentioning another aspect of the Falcon's fame that is unrelated to its speed - that she earned prestige for surviving a dangerous short-distanced Kessel Run, as well as being "fast".

A more straightforward explanation is that [[George Lucas]], in writing the script, simply did not remember or realize that parsecs are not time measurements.  According to some sources, Lucas did realize this, but wished to portray Han Solo as an absent-minded braggart who simply did not know what he was talking about.  The bemused reactions of [[Obi-Wan Kenobi]] and [[Luke Skywalker]] to Han's quip suggest that this could be the case.
